Polish Presidency of the EU Council


Every six months a different member state of the European Union holds the Presidency presiding over the work of the Council of the European Union.

At the same time the state holding the Presidency becomes the host of most of the Union's events and plays a key role in all the fields of activity of the European Union. It is responsible for the organization of EU meetings, sets the Union's political direction and ensures its development, integration and security.
